New shot blasting chambers in Latvia: metal cleaning of any size, from huge beams to tiny parts
06.08.2026 - 16:34
Italian Machinery Association has completed a large-scale project involving the installation of three automated shot blasting lines: an automatic chamber for large parts, a manual chamber for oversized items, and an automatic chamber for small components.
Thanks to the new equipment, the production facility in Daugavpils has significantly increased the speed and quality of surface cleaning — metal is now effectively cleared of rust, scale, and old coatings before painting or further processing. A flexible line of chambers allows the enterprise to handle virtually any task: from preparing massive metal structures and beds to delicately processing small precision parts where accuracy is paramount. Such a comprehensive approach not only boosts productivity and reduces labor costs, but also opens up new opportunities to expand the range of orders and strengthen the company's position in the metalworking market.
